ANNOUNCEMENT
IVANOVO STATE UNIVERSITY
YAROSLAVL STATE UNIVERSITY
IVANOVO CENTER FOR GENDER STUDIES
With the financial assistance of the Institute "Open Society" (Russia)
and HESP
from July 23 till August 12, 2001 organize Summer School in Pljos (Ivanovo
region)
"GENDER PEDAGOGICS AND GENDER EDUCATION IN THE POST-SOVIET SPACE: PROSPECTS
OF DEVELOPMENT"
Summer school is directed on introduction and perfection of a technique of
teaching gender courses in a higher school. It is focused on the teachers of
high schools, both having some experience of their teaching, and making
first steps in this direction. The summer school is designed for 40
participants from Russia, NIS, Mongolia and countries of East Europe. They
will be selected according to the results of open contest. An international
command of the teachers from the universities of Ivanovo, Yaroslavl, Moscow,
Samara, Tver, Toronto (Canada), Oulu (Finland), Georgetown (USA) was
composed. At summer school it is supposed to discuss and to develop
recommendations for the solution of the problems in teaching gender courses
and to generalize of the best practices of teaching gender courses and
organization of gender education both at Russian, and at foreign
universities. Summer school will be located in a comfortable tourist inn on
the bank of the Volga River. Languages: Russian and English. The Summer
School Budget covers entirely the accommodation and food expenses as well as
a part of the travel expenses (the sum of reimbursements of travel expenses
will depend from the cost of the ticket, but participants have to find the
cheapest variant of travelling to summer school).
Main courses:
1. History of women's education in Russia and abroad
2. Methodology and psychology of teaching gender courses .
3. Gender and women's studies: Western experience.
4. Integration of gender problems in the humanitarian disciplines.
At the end of training every participant must present and defend essay or
original programme of educational course. It is recommended to bring
preparatory materials in order to have enough leisure time, because
programme of the School envisages several excursions to the towns of the
Russian "Gold Ring" (Yaroslavl, Kostroma, Suzdal). The best essays and
programmes will be included in the manual, which will be published and
distributed among universities, and placed in the web-site of the Summer
School.
